Buying Guide for the Best Moth Repellents

Choosing the right moth repellent is important to protect your clothes, fabrics, and stored items from moth damage. There are several types of moth repellents available, each with its own strengths and best-use scenarios. When picking a moth repellent, consider where you’ll use it, how sensitive you are to scents or chemicals, and how long you need protection. Understanding the key features will help you select the most effective and convenient option for your needs.
Type of RepellentMoth repellents come in various forms such as sachets, sprays, blocks, balls, and strips. The type refers to the physical form and method of application. Sachets and blocks are often placed in drawers or closets, while sprays are used directly on fabrics or in storage areas. Balls and strips are hung or placed in storage spaces. The choice depends on your storage setup and personal preference. For example, sachets are great for small, enclosed spaces, while sprays are useful for treating larger areas or specific items.
Active IngredientThe active ingredient is the substance that actually repels or kills moths. Common ingredients include natural oils (like cedar or lavender), chemical compounds (such as naphthalene or paradichlorobenzene), and herbal blends. Natural ingredients are generally safer for people and pets and have a pleasant scent, but may need to be replaced more often. Chemical options are usually more potent and longer-lasting, but can have strong odors and may not be suitable for sensitive individuals. Choose based on your sensitivity, safety needs, and desired effectiveness.
Duration of EffectivenessThis refers to how long the repellent remains effective before needing replacement or reapplication. Some products last only a few weeks, while others can work for several months. Shorter durations may require more frequent maintenance but can be safer or more natural, while longer-lasting options are more convenient for long-term storage. Consider how often you want to check and replace the repellent when making your choice.
ScentThe scent is an important factor, as moth repellents often have a noticeable smell. Some people prefer natural, pleasant scents like cedar or lavender, while others may be sensitive to strong chemical odors. If you are storing items in living spaces or are sensitive to smells, opt for lightly scented or unscented options. For storage in less-used areas, a stronger scent may be acceptable.
SafetySafety refers to how safe the product is for humans and pets. Some chemical moth repellents can be toxic if ingested or inhaled in large amounts, so they may not be suitable for homes with children or pets. Natural repellents are generally safer but may be less effective. Always check the safety information and choose a product that matches your household’s needs.
Ease of UseEase of use describes how simple it is to apply or set up the repellent. Some products require hanging, placing, or spraying, while others may need to be replaced or refreshed regularly. If you prefer a low-maintenance solution, look for products that are easy to use and require minimal upkeep.
